Carolina Panthers quarterback Bryce Young ranked 98th on the NFL's Top 100 players list, indicating strong respect from league peers. This recognition comes as the Panthers consider his future with the team following a season where he led them to an NFC South title despite a record of 8-9. Young's performance has shown significant improvement, and the organization remains optimistic about his development. His calm demeanor and ability to perform in crucial moments have garnered praise from fellow athletes, reinforcing the Panthers' confidence in him.
